Ornithopter flight forces are typically measured with the body fixed to a force sensor. Here, we demonstrate the identification of free flight aerodynamic forces at a stable equilibrium point of an ornithopter and compare them with the tethered flight aerodynamic forces. For this demonstration, we have developed a closed-loop altitude regulation for the ornithopter using an external camera and custom made onboard electronics. The results show that the tethered aerodynamic force measurement of a 12 gram ornithopter with zero induced velocity underestimates the total flight force by 24.8 mN.
